What makes this role exciting


---------------------------------

CloudPay is seeking an experienced UK Payroll Manager to lead and grow our UK payroll operations within a fast-paced, collaborative environment. This is an exciting opportunity for a payroll leader who empowers teams, thrives on responsibility, team leadership, and takes pride in delivering payroll services that truly support clients and their people.


----------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------

In this role, you will lead and develop the UK payroll operations team, creating an environment where diverse perspectives are welcomed, and everyone is set up to succeed, while ensuring accurate, compliant, and timely payroll delivery for CloudPay's UK customers.


----------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------

Main responsibilities


-------------------------

Manage the UK Payroll operations team, with direct management of those staff in the UK and indirect management for those in the EDP team (Philippines)

----------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------

Have overall responsibility for the allocation and processing of Payrolls for UK customers, and for ensuring accurate and timely delivery of Payrolls.

----------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------

Close monitoring and responsible for performance management of the team, and be able to drive operational excellence (Quality of the delivery: SLA... and Quality of the interaction: Tickets...) and facilitate upskill and a learning culture.

----------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------

Ensure Supervisors and Processors are best positioned for Service delivery to Clients with operational issues, including customer reviews, implementation issues and product teams.

---------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------

Proactively manage Customer relations, avoiding any unnecessary escalation to the EMEA Payroll Director and ensuring Service Reviews are held as required.

--------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------

Interview and hire new team members, and assist with onboarding and training to ensure the team is properly skilled throughout the employee life cycle.

-----------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------

Act as a backup to Supervisors during their absence on payroll processing issues.

-------------------------------------------------------------------------------------

Handle all payroll matters and queries from clients on time and be viewed by Clients as a facilitator to support Service Delivery and as a reliable and actionable escalation point.

----------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------

Co-operate with other departments within CloudPay, seeking continuous improvement and strengthening the One CloudPay image for Customers

---------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------

Experience needed for this role


-----------------------------------

Extensive knowledge and experience in Payroll processing.

-------------------------------------------------------------

Experience in supervising and managing a team.

--------------------------------------------------

Experience in dealing with customer escalations.

----------------------------------------------------

Strong knowledge of UK statutory legislation.

-------------------------------------------------

Project management.

-----------------------

Knowledge management and precise document management skills

---------------------------------------------------------------

High level of problem-solving and solution-focused

--------------------------------------------------------

Results driven

------------------

Confident in managing internal and external stakeholders at all levels.

---------------------------------------------------------------------------

Good work practice in accountability and ownership.
